How much does it cost to rent an apartment in La Marque?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 77568 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,285 | $799 | $2,500 |
| 77568 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,784 | $1,215 | $2,550 |
| 77568 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,122 | $2,009 | $5,840 |

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 77568?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 77568 range from $1,215 to $2,550,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,215 to $2,550.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,009 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,009.
